What is the main responsibility of the Support Program Manager?
The main responsibility of the Support Program Manager is to optimize Distributor performance and identify areas for improvement within the Distributor Support Program.
What regions will the Program Manager oversee?
The Program Manager will oversee the support performance of distributors across the Middle East, APAC, and ANZ regions.
What qualifications are required for this position?
A degree in a technical or management discipline or extensive experience in program management in a similar role is required, along with good technical knowledge and experience with Fortinet products and technologies.
Is proficiency in multiple languages necessary for this role?
While excellent command of English (written and spoken) is required, proficiency in additional languages is considered a plus.
What are the key skills needed for this role?
Key skills include exceptional organizational abilities, strong negotiation and communication skills, analytical and problem-solving skills, and the ability to adapt to changing priorities.
What type of work environment can one expect in this role?
The role requires the 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
Will the Program Manager need to handle customer inquiries?
Yes, the Program Manager will handle incoming and outgoing inquiries from distributors, sales teams, and other Fortinet departments.
Is a Fortinet Certified Professional (FCP) certification preferred?
Yes, having an FCP certification is preferred for candidates applying for this position.
How important is it for the candidate to have a customer-oriented mindset?
A customer-oriented mindset is crucial; the candidate should be self-motivated, reliable, and proactive in addressing partner inquiries.
Will the Program Manager be responsible for facilitating meetings?
Yes, the Program Manager will efficiently facilitate team and partner meetings as part of their responsibilities.
